Grâce-Emmanuelle
Also spelled: Grace-Emmanuelle, Grace, Emmanuelle
Pronunciation: GRAHSS-eh-mah-NWELL
Meaning
Grace of God is with us
Origin
Latin and Hebrew
About Grâce-Emmanuelle
Grâce-Emmanuelle is a name that beautifully marries two profound concepts, offering a spiritual elegance that feels both classic and distinctly contemporary. This double-barreled French gem, meaning "Grace of God is with us," carries a gentle strength and a lyrical flow that sets it apart. It’s perfect for parents who appreciate names with deep meaning and a sophisticated, feminine appeal, especially those looking for a name rooted in Christian tradition but with a unique, unburdened quality. Unlike many compound names, Grâce-Emmanuelle doesn't feel overly long or formal; instead, it glides off the tongue with a refined charm, suggesting a child who is both poised and full of light. Its rarity ensures a sense of individuality, offering a fresh alternative to more common biblical choices.

Frequently Asked Questions About Grâce-Emmanuelle
What is the cultural significance of Grâce-Emmanuelle?
The name has strong Biblical and Christian associations, combining the virtue of "Grace" with "God is with us," a direct reference to Immanuel.
